Ubiquiti Pro Max Aggregation (USW-Pro-Max-Aggregation)
Ubiquiti Pro Max Aggregation (USW-Pro-Max-Aggregation)
★ 5.0 Value Score

Technical Specifications

  • Switching Capacity: 760 Gbps
  • Forwarding Rate: 565.44 Mpps
  • Ports: (28) 10G SFP+, (4) 25G SFP28
  • PoE Budget: N/A
  • Layer: L3
  • Stacking support: No (Hardware Stacking)

Curation Review

  • ✔ Pros: Features Etherlighting™ for visual port/VLAN management, 25G SFP28 uplinks for high-speed backbone, Full Layer 3 switching capabilities, Fanless silent operation.
  • ✘ Cons: Higher price premium for Etherlighting compared to Pro Aggregation, requires expensive SFP+ or SFP28 transceivers, no dedicated hardware stacking ports.
  • Est. Price: $949 - $999

Cisco Catalyst 9500
Cisco Catalyst 9500
★ 3.3 Value Score

Technical Specifications

  • Switching Capacity: 38.4 Tbps
  • Forwarding Rate: 2.56-38.4 Tbps (configuration-dependent)
  • Ports: Modular: 12-40 ports (10GbE to 400GbE capable)
  • Port Breakdown: C9500-12Q: 12u00d7100GbE QSFP28; C9500-40X: 40u00d710GbE SFP+
  • PoE Budget: Optional - available on select linecards
  • Layer Support: L2/L3 (Multi-layer)
  • Stacking Support: Yes - up to 8 units
  • Throughput (Aggregate): Up to 38.4 Tbps per chassis
  • Redundancy: Dual supervisors, dual power supplies

Curation Review

  • ✔ Pros: Modular design enables flexible port configurations and future upgrades; Industry-leading switching capacity (38.4 Tbps) for carrier-grade deployments; Advanced L3 routing with sophisticated QoS, security, and multicast capabilities; Stackable architecture supports seamless scaling to 8 units; Cisco IOS XE OS provides extensive features, automation, and security; Exceptional support for high-density 100GbE/400GbE connectivity
  • ✘ Cons: Extremely high capital expenditure ($150K–$500K+) unsuitable for small/medium deployments; Complex modular architecture requires significant operational expertise; High power consumption and cooling requirements; Licensing costs can add 30–50% to acquisition price; Over-engineered for most enterprise use cases; Limited ROI for organizations not requiring carrier-grade performance
  • Est. Price: $150,000 - $500,000
